Incentive travel programs are so effective at maximizing sales performance that every large and many mid-sized companies run one.  These "President’s Club" programs motivate sales reps and managers to sell to the best of their abilities and reward the top achievers with spots luxury trips to highly desirable resorts around the world. Yes, these trips are expensive but if properly structured, they are investments that provide a return-on-investment (ROI).
